The Internship experience is designed to develop student athletes in discerning their calling and career while introducing them to various aspects of ministry through FCA. FCA Interns are collegiate volunteers who engage through FCA in a learning and developmental ministry experience during a summer or a semester. Interns who are serving through FCA are not employees and do not receive compensation by the hour or for production of their work. Interns serving with FCA may receive a nominal stipend for living related expenses during the course of the internship. FCA internship experiences vary from location to locations; however, the primary goal of each internship is to develop the intern's understanding of his/her individual calling to ministry through related training and experience. Further information about each specific internship is available by contacting the FCA staff associated with this posting. The 10-week summer internship can be viewed in two buckets: 1. Personal Growth - We pour into our intern team with Christ-centered faith and leadership development. 2. Kingdom Growth - We give our interns the opportunity to take what they've learned and put it into action with local FCA huddles, camps, and events. This is a part-time internship (20-25 hours a week) for 9 weeks from Tuesday, June 9 to Friday, August 7. The week of July 4th is off (June 29 - July 5). Local Interns will have the option, if approved by FCA staff, to stay on as an intern for the school year volunteering with local high school campus huddles as leaders. This internship will focus on Christ-centered leadership training and ministry opportunities such as: Leading and directing summer FCA camps [https://minnesotafca.org/camp] Serving as Huddle Leaders at the Northland FCA Regional Sports Camp [https://northlandfca.org/sports-camp] and Leadership Camp [https://northlandfca.org/lead-camp] Mentoring high school leaders involved in their FCA campus ministry Participating in FCA fundraising events Building relationships with other like-minded ministries and churches Experiencing other areas of sports ministry Interns will be responsible for raising part of their stipend within Minnesota FCA guidelines.
